    Zip code 94103 centers on SoMa’s flatter, sunnier-by-SF-standards microclimate, with breezy afternoons and fewer foggy mornings than the west side. Expect converted warehouses, modern lofts, and creative spaces near downtown, anchored by SFMOMA, Yerba Buena Center for the Arts, and the Contemporary Jewish Museum. The vibe is urban, inventive, and nightlife-forward, with music venues and clubs along 11th and Folsom and festivals like the Folsom Street Fair reflecting the area’s LGBTQ leather and maker heritage. Recent Zillow market trends show a median asking rent in the low-to-mid $3,000s, with most homes ranging from the upper $2,000s to around $4,500+, depending on size and amenities. Daily life is convenient and walkable: groceries at Trader Joe’s on 9th, Rainbow Grocery, or Costco; coffee at Sightglass or Blue Bottle at Mint Plaza; and bites at District Six or The Market on Market. Fitness options include Fitness SF SoMa and neighborhood studios; green breaks at Victoria Manalo Draves Park, SoMa West Dog Park and Skatepark, and Yerba Buena Gardens. Excellent transit via BART, Muni, bike lanes, and quick links to I‑80 and US‑101. Pet friendly, with urban energy more than suburban calm.
